"grada" meaning in Catalan

See grada in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

IPA: [ˈɡɾa.ðə] [Balearic, Central, Northern], [ˈɡɾa.ða] [Northwestern, Valencia] Audio: LL-Q7026 (cat)-Marvives-grada.wav (note: Barcelona) Forms: grades [plural]
Etymology: Inherited from Vulgar Latin *grada, collective of gradus (“step”).   1. a wide step, especially one large enough to sit on; bleacher Tags: feminine

  2. stairway Tags: feminine Synonyms: graderia

  3. (architecture) gradin, gradine Tags: feminine

  4. (linguistics) tier Tags: feminine

  5. (nautical) slipway Tags: feminine Synonyms: estepa
